2

UIDynamicAnimator を CGAffineTransform を持つビューと一緒に再生するにはどうすればよいですか?

self.transform = CGAffineTransformMakeScale(0.5, 0.5); 

UIDynamicAnimator を実行すると、スケールは通常の状態に戻ります。

前もって感謝します

4

2 に答える 2

0

サイズが設定された後にオブジェクトをアニメーターに追加すると、問題ないはずです。動的アニメーターは変換を 1 回読み取り、その後のみ書き込みます。後でサイズを変更した場合は、オブジェクトを動作から削除し、サイズを変更してから再度追加する必要があります。または、オブジェクトを UIView に追加してアニメーターに追加するだけで、いつでもオブジェクトのサイズを変更でき、アニメーターは気にしません。

于 2013-10-04T07:31:34.770 に答える